I have the following Toy Example code in which I create two tabs within a wxPython notebook. There is a button to add new pages and within each page I want to have a button that closes the page. However the below code does no action when clicking on the close buttons.
import wx
class TabPanel(wx.Panel):
def __init__(self, parent, pageNum):
self.parent = parent
self.pageNum = pageNum
wx.Panel.__init__(self, parent=parent)
btn = wx.Button(self, label="Close Page " + str(pageNum))
sizer = wx.BoxSizer(wx.VERTICAL)
sizer.Add(btn, 0, wx.ALL, 10)
self.SetSizer(sizer)
btn.Bind(wx.EVT_BUTTON, self.closeTab)
def closeTab(self,event):
self.Close()
class DemoFrame(wx.Frame):
def __init__(self):
wx.Frame.__init__(self, None, wx.ID_ANY, "Notebook", size=(600,400))
panel = wx.Panel(self)
self.tab_num = 2
self.notebook = wx.Notebook(panel)
tabOne = TabPanel(self.notebook, 1)
self.notebook.AddPage(tabOne, "Page 1")
tabTwo = TabPanel(self.notebook, 2)
self.notebook.AddPage(tabTwo, "Page 2")
sizer = wx.BoxSizer(wx.VERTICAL)
sizer.Add(self.notebook, 1, wx.ALL|wx.EXPAND, 5)
btn = wx.Button(panel, label="Add Page")
btn.Bind(wx.EVT_BUTTON, self.addPage)
sizer.Add(btn)
panel.SetSizer(sizer)
self.Layout()
self.Show()
def addPage(self, event):
self.tab_num += 1
new_tab = TabPanel(self.notebook, self.tab_num)
self.notebook.AddPage(new_tab, "Page %s" % self.tab_num)
if __name__ == "__main__":
app = wx.App(False)
frame = DemoFrame()
app.MainLoop()
That code produces below window:
Problem
The close buttons aren't doing any action.
Question
How should I change my code in order to get the close button to close the corresponding page where it's located?
